Significance of Divine representation

Divine representation encompasses various interpretations across different contexts within Hinduism. In Vaishnavism, it highlights the diverse forms of Krishna and Ananta's service to the Lord. The Purana emphasizes physical images or idols integral to worship. Kavya focuses on artistic depictions that evoke a sense of holiness, often linked to royalty. Additionally, in the context of Indian history, letters of the alphabet are viewed as divine, and the peacock is associated with several deities, showcasing the multifaceted nature of divine representation.
